How to Make Chipotle Sauce (Step-by-Step Guide)

Making a tasty chipotle sauce at home is easy with this recipe. The secret to a smoky and creamy sauce is in the simple steps. Begin by mixing all the key ingredients – chipotle peppers, sour cream, mayonnaise, lime juice, cumin, and oregano – in a food processor or blender.

Blend the mix for 30 to 60 seconds until it’s smooth and creamy. Taste it and adjust the seasonings if needed. For more heat, add more chipotle peppers. Once you’re happy with the flavor, scoop the chipotle sauce into an airtight container. It might thicken in the fridge, but its taste and texture will stay great.

Customizing Your Chipotle Sauce Recipe’s Heat Level

Homemade spicy chipotle sauce lets you adjust the heat to your liking. You can choose a gentle warmth or a bold kick. It all depends on how many chipotle peppers you use.

Adjusting Chipotle Pepper Quantities

Begin with one chipotle pepper in adobo sauce. Then, add more until you get the spice you want. For a milder mild chipotle sauce, start with 1/4 teaspoon of chipotle powder or one pepper. For more heat, add up to 2 whole peppers.

Balancing Flavors with Additional Ingredients

To balance the heat, consider adding fresh lime juice or a touch of honey. For a sweeter twist, try incorporating flavors from this Churro Cheesecake Recipe. The lime’s acidity helps tone down the spiciness, while the honey introduces a pleasant sweetness for contrast. You can also try smoked paprika or a pinch of cayenne pepper for extra flavor.

Spice Level Variations

  • Mild Chipotle Sauce: 1/4 teaspoon chipotle powder or 1 chipotle pepper
  • Medium Chipotle Sauce: 1/2 teaspoon chipotle powder or 1-2 chipotle peppers
  • Spicy Chipotle Sauce: 1 teaspoon chipotle powder or 2 chipotle peppers

Storage Tips for Easy Chipotle Recipe Sauce

Keeping your homemade chipotle sauce fresh is key. With the right storage, you can enjoy it for a long time. Here’s how to keep your chipotle sauce storage and homemade sauce shelf life in check.

Refrigeration Guidelines

Keep your chipotle sauce in an airtight container in the fridge. It can last up to 2 weeks this way. Need storage advice for other recipes? Learn how to keep Easy Lasagna Soup fresh. Additionally, mark the container with the preparation date for easy reference.

Freezing Methods

Freezing is great for longer storage. Pour the sauce into ice cube trays or small containers. Leave a bit of space for it to expand. Frozen, it can last up to 3 months. Just thaw it in the fridge when you’re ready to use it.

Signs of Spoilage

Watch for signs of spoilage. Mold, bad smells, or color changes mean it’s time to throw it away. Storing it in airtight containers keeps it fresh and prevents air from getting in.

Dietary Substitutions for Creamy Chipotle Dip

The Easy Chipotle Sauce Recipe can be changed to fit many diets. For a vegan chipotle sauce, swap Greek yogurt for plant-based yogurt. Also, use vegan mayonnaise instead of regular.

To make it low-fat, replace sour cream with Greek yogurt. This keeps it creamy but cuts down on calories and fat.

For a lighter sauce, add more Greek yogurt or use low-fat mayonnaise. If you can’t use honey, try agave syrup instead. These tweaks let you make the sauce fit your diet while keeping its great taste.

Chipotle Sauce Recipe

Easy Chipotle Sauce

A quick and flavorful chipotle sauce perfect for tacos, burgers, or as a dipping sauce.
5 from 1 vote
Prep Time 5 minutes
Total Time 5 minutes
Course Sauce
Cuisine Mexican-American
Servings 8
Calories 120 kcal

Equipment

  • Blender or food processor (notes: for blending the sauce)
  • Measuring cups and spoons

Ingredients
  

  • 1 cup Mayonnaise
  • 2 Chipotle peppers in adobo sauce notes: adjust to taste
  • 1 tbsp Adobo sauce notes: from the chipotle can
  • 1 tbsp Lime juice notes: fresh
  • 1 clove Garlic notes: minced
  • 1/4 tsp Salt notes: or to taste

Instructions
 

  • Add mayonnaise, chipotle peppers, adobo sauce, lime juice, garlic, and salt to a blender or food processor.
  • Blend until smooth and creamy.
  • Taste and adjust seasoning or spice level as desired.
  • Transfer to a jar or bowl and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to allow the flavors to meld.

Notes

For a lighter version, substitute half the mayonnaise with Greek yogurt.

FAQ

How long does homemade chipotle sauce last?

Store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 2 weeks. Freeze in small portions for up to 3 months.

How do I adjust the spice level?

Start with one chipotle pepper for mild, then add more for extra heat. You can also balance spice with honey or lime juice.

Can I make this chipotle sauce without mayo?

Yes! Swap mayo for Greek yogurt or sour cream for a lighter, tangy version.
